Comprehending Mental Health Assessment
A mental health assessment is a structured process that includes assessing an individual's psychological, psychological, and social well-being to determine mental illness. The assessment aims to comprehend the client's issues and develop an effective treatment strategy.
Key Components of Mental Health Assessment
A comprehensive mental health assessment generally includes the following elements:
Clinical Interview: The primary step where the mental health professional gathers info about the customer's history, symptoms, and life situations.
Behavioral Observations: Professionals observe the client's habits during the assessment to gather insights into their emotion.
Standardized Tests and Questionnaires: These are used to measure the severity of symptoms and compare them to normative data.
Diagnostic Criteria: Utilizing handbooks such as the DSM-5 (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ders), professionals detect specific mental health concerns based upon reported symptoms and habits.
Danger Assessment: This involves examining whether the specific positions a danger to themselves or others, especially in cases of suicidal ideation or self-harm.

Counseling is a restorative process where people engage with an experienced mental health professional to deal with individual, social, or psychological difficulties. It is a necessary element of mental healthcare that matches assessment and diagnosis.
Kinds Of Counseling Approaches
A number of therapeutic approaches can be utilized in counseling, each with its own strategies and viewpoints:
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T): Focuses on identifying and altering unfavorable idea patterns and behaviors.
Psychodynamic Therapy: Explores unconscious inspirations and previous experiences to understand existing behavior.
Humanistic Therapy: Emphasizes personal growth and self-actualization, allowing clients to explore their sensations in a helpful environment.
Family Therapy: Addresses family dynamics and relationships, concentrating on enhancing communication and resolving conflicts.
Group Therapy: Involves a small group of people working together under the guidance of a therapist to share experiences and supply support.

Mental health assessment and counseling are related. An extensive assessment is essential in properly diagnosing mental health conditions, informing appropriate counseling approaches. Conversely, the development made throughout counseling can offer continuous feedback to improve assessment tools and techniques. This integration causes enhanced mental health outcomes for people.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Why is mental health assessment essential?
A mental health assessment is essential for early detection of issues, helping to tailor treatment strategies that can significantly enhance an individual's quality of life.
2. What can I anticipate during a mental health assessment?
People can anticipate a structured interview, numerous tests or questionnaires, and a conversation about their mental health history. It might also consist of assessments of danger aspects.
3. How long does counseling last?
The period of counseling varies depending upon individual needs, the specific problems being dealt with, and the goals set in between the therapist and the customer. Sessions typically last from a few weeks to numerous months.
4. Can anyone gain from mental health counseling?
Definitely. Counseling can be advantageous for anyone dealing with psychological difficulties, tension, relationship issues, or seeking personal growth.
5. Is mental health counseling personal?
Yes, mental health counseling is private, with legal and ethical guidelines guaranteeing the personal privacy of the customer's info.
